The Undertaker's Deadliest Matches is a DVD produced by IWE on one of the IWE legends in the business; The Undertaker packed with 15 matches including his Inferno match with his younger brother Kane and other matches with the links of The Ultimate Warrior, Kamala, King Mable, Mankind, Stone Cold Steve Johnson, Kevin McAlmond, and The Great Khali in matches such as "Casket matches" "Body Bag matches", "Boiler Room matches"
